SYMPTOMS OF TOXIC OVERLOAD
Flora Health Research Academy, 2002
by Dr. David Wikenheiser
Toxins are substances that will interrupt or completely block the
normal metabolic functions of the body.
Metabolic functions include moving nutrients into our cells, processing
and eliminating wastes,
producing energy, making repairs, and growing replacement cells.
Detoxification is the processing and elimination of toxins from the
body, and it is an essential part of regaining and maintaining good
health.
Food provides the body with nutrients, which are the building blocks
for health. Nutrients are released from food through digestion.
Poorly digested foods will not only limit the amount of nutrients
available to be absorbed,
but will increase the toxic burden on the body through fermentation.
Undigested foods will not merely pass unchanged out of the body, but
will ferment and produce gases and
other toxic byproducts,
which will be reabsorbed by the body.
These digestion originating endogenous toxins, along with exogenous
toxins originating outside of the body,
will burden and limit normal bodily functions.
Toxic substances include: heavy metals, such as mercury and lead;
solvents,
such as benzene; plastics, such as styrene; hormones and
chemicals acting as hormones; and, free radical compounds.
I consider free radicals to be the number one class of toxins.
A free radical is an unbalanced chemical structure that will pull electrons
from other structures, damaging them in the process.
Free radicals may originate from poor digestion, uncontrolled emotional
stress, and pollution from the world around us.
Oxygen has the ability to pull electrons off of other chemical
structures, which is necessary
for our efficient cellular energy production and the operation of
our immune system.
While oxygen is essential for life, if uncontrolled it will create toxic
free radicals and increase our risk of developing diseases.
Free radicals will act against our bodies by directly "burning" our
cells, damaging our DNA and increasing our risk of developing diseases through the altering of
our genetic expression.
Altered genetic expression may lead to the emergence of dormant
diseases such as cancer, Hepatitis C, and AIDS.
Virtually every person has symptoms of toxic load
How do you know if you have a toxic load?
Laboratory tests are useful to screen for toxins in general, and to measure levels of specific toxins.
Before a doctor will order laboratory tests they will take a history of
symptoms to determine which tests are the most appropriate.
The symptoms associated with toxic load include neurological,
immunological, and endocrine symptoms.
The neurological, or nerve related symptoms associated with a toxic
load include: tingling hands and feet, and alterations in mood, such as
anxiety, aggression, and depression.
The immunological or immune system symptoms associated with a toxic load may include:
a down regulation of white blood cells, resulting in frequent or unreasonably severe infections; an up regulation of the
immunoglobulin proteins, resulting in frequent and severe allergic
reactions.
The endocrine, or hormonal symptoms associated with a toxic load
include:
pancreatic dysfunction leading to poor digestion and poor blood sugar
regulation, leading to weight gain; adrenal
burnout, leading to unreasonable coffee consumption, irritability,
and the inability to relax or handle stress;
PMS and premature menopause in women, and andropause in men; thyroid dysfunction and
the symptoms of weight gain, constipation, dry skin, hair loss,
fatigue, and sleeping long hours only to wake unrested.
Virtually every person I know has at least one of these symptoms of
toxic load.
Managing a toxic burden will take several steps: one, avoid further
exposures;
two, support the processing of toxic substances; and
three, support the removal of toxic substances from the body by way
of the routes of elimination.
Avoiding further toxic exposures includes eating organic foods, using
natural nontoxic cleaners in
our homes, spending less time per day in heavy traffic, removing
mercury amalgam dental restorations, and improving digestion.
Poor digestion will lead to fermentation of the undigested foods.
This fermentation will produce digestive tract gas and bloating, as well
as toxic and re-absorbable byprod-ucts such as phenyl compounds,
indican, scatol, and cadaveral.
Processing toxins will be supported by adequate intake of
antioxidant compounds to quench free radicals,
and the adequate intake of nutrient supplements and herbal formulas
to support the liver in its role of cleaning and processing toxins
from the blood.
Elimination of these processed toxins from the body is supported by the
intake of dietary fiber, adequate water intake,
and adequate exercise.
Adequate dietary fiber will result in at least one normal bowel movement
per day. A normal bowel movement is the size and consistency of a large
peeled banana.
Adequate water intake may be calculated by dividing your body weight in
pounds, by two, to give you the number of ounces per day. For example, aperson who weighs one hundred and fifty pounds will ideally drink a
minimum of seventy-five ounces of suitable fluids per day.
Suitable fluids include herbal teas, fruit and vegetable juices, and
water.
Removing waste gases from the blood, by adequately stimulating the
lungs, requires a minimum of thirty minutes per day of brisk exercise
such as walking.
